About Manningtree, England
Manningtree, a charming town nestled on the banks of the River Stour in Essex, England, offers a delightful blend of history, natural beauty, and a relaxed, friendly atmosphere. It's the kind of place where you can easily lose yourself exploring quaint streets, enjoying riverside walks, and soaking up the quintessential English countryside vibe. Transportation Options in Manningtree
Manningtree is easily accessible by train, making it a convenient destination for travellers. Once in Manningtree, walking is the best way to explore the town centre. For exploring the surrounding areas, consider cycling or using local bus services.
